Technical Highlights:

1. Near-Infrared (NIR) Sorting Technology

Near-infrared spectroscopy sensors identify different materials based on the unique spectral reflection signals in the near-infrared band. NIR detection technology sorts materials by color and material, providing an efficient solution to ensure the purity of PET products.

2. Flying Beam™ Scanning Technology

This technology performs continuous signal correction and integrates a light source to ensure uniform illumination. Through continuous and stable calibration functions, it can monitor and optimize the entire system's performance in real-time, ensuring stable high output and quality. Additionally, this innovative technology can save up to 70% of energy consumption and operate stably within a wide range of environmental temperatures (5 – 50°C).

Main Application Areas:

PET flake purification, transparent and opaque flake purification, flake color sorting

About Us
TOMRA's resource recovery business is a renowned industry leader, focusing on designing and manufacturing sensor-based sorting systems for the global recycling and waste management industries. TOMRA's sorting equipment is suitable for sorting various types of solid waste. Its sensor-based optical sorting technology can accurately sort different types of plastics (such as PET, HDPE, LDPE, PP, PC, etc.) from mixed plastic waste, producing high-purity recycled materials that rival virgin materials, which are used for high-quality recycling. TOMRA's sorting technology is also applicable to the sorting of multiple types of solid waste, capable of flexibly handling various complex sorting tasks, including household waste, mixed packaging, mixed waste paper, mixed metals, and scrap steel shredder tailings, from which it can accurately sort out high-purity recyclable components (such as stainless steel, wires, and various non-ferrous metals). Founded in Norway in 1972, TOMRA innovatively designed and developed the reverse vending machines for beverage containers, which have been widely used globally. Today, with its leading technology and advanced recycling and sorting systems, TOMRA serves the food, recycling, and mining industries, committed to optimizing resource utilization, reducing resource wastage, and promoting the circular economy. TOMRA is listed on the Oslo Stock Exchange with the ticker symbol TOM. In 2022, TOMRA had over 100,000 installations worldwide, generating a total revenue of 12.2 billion Norwegian Kroner. Currently, TOMRA has more than 5,000 employees and operates in over 100 countries and regions, with regional headquarters, manufacturing centers, and offices across Europe, the Americas, Asia, Africa, and Oceania.
